在 Vue 中使用 layui 可行。有两种集成方法:使用 vue-layui 插件,该插件提供了 layui API 的 Vue 绑定。手动导入 layui 并注册全局组件。集成 layui 的优点包括简化控件使用、提高开发效率和轻松访问强大功能。

layui 在 Vue 中的使用
layui 可以吗?
是的,layui 可以集成在 Vue 项目中,无需担心兼容性问题。
集成方法
立即学习“前端免费学习笔记(深入)”;
有两种主要方法可以将 layui 与 Vue 集成:
Vue 插件:安装 vue-layui 插件,它提供了layui API 的 Vue 绑定。
示例:
<code class="javascript">import Vue from 'vue'; import VueLayui from 'vue-layui'; Vue.use(VueLayui);</code>
手动集成:直接将 layui 导入项目并注册全局组件。
示例:
<code class="javascript">import layui from 'layui';
Vue.component('my-layui-component', {
template: '<div></div>',
created() {
layui.form.render();
},
});</code>注意事项
优势
将 layui 集成到 Vue 中的主要优势包括:
示例
以下是一个简单的 Vue 组件,使用 layui 表单元素:
<code class="javascript"><template>
<div>
<form class="layui-form">
<label>姓名:</label>
<input type="text" name="name">
<button type="submit" class="layui-btn">提交</button>
</form>
</div>
</template>
<script>
export default {
created() {
layui.form.render();
},
};
</script></code>通过使用 vue-layui 插件,可以轻松访问 layui API 并创建复杂的组件:
<code class="javascript"><template>
<l-table :data="tableData"></l-table>
</template>
<script>
import { lTable } from 'vue-layui';
export default {
components: {
lTable,
},
data() {
return {
tableData: { /* table data */ },
};
},
};
</script></code>
每个人都需要一台速度更快、更稳定的 PC。随着时间的推移,垃圾文件、旧注册表数据和不必要的后台进程会占用资源并降低性能。幸运的是,许多工具可以让 Windows 保持平稳运行。
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号